Mig Welding Wire Material

Mig welding wire material plays a key role in welding quality and strength. Choosing the right wire ensures clean, strong, and reliable welds.

Mig welding wire comes in various types for different metals and welding needs. Carbon steel wires like ER70S-6 offer low spatter and good weld quality for mild steel projects. Flux core wires provide gasless welding, ideal for outdoor work and thicker metals.

Aluminum welding wires, such as ER5356, suit lightweight and corrosion-resistant applications. Factors like wire diameter, coating, and compatibility with your welder affect performance. Understanding these options helps you pick the best wire for your welding tasks, improving efficiency and results. The PGN Solid MIG Welding Wire is designed to deliver consistent performance across multiple welding positions, making it versatile for various tasks. Its ER70S-6 classification indicates a high manganese and silicon content, which enhances the wire’s ability to withstand surface contaminants such as rust or mill scale. This feature is especially beneficial for welders working in less-than-ideal conditions, reducing defects and improving overall weld quality. The .035 inch diameter size strikes a balance between precision and penetration, suitable for thin to medium thickness materials.

Additionally, the low spatter characteristic of this wire means less slag formation and minimal cleanup, saving valuable time post-weld. The inclusion of high levels of deoxidizers helps prevent porosity and other weld imperfections, resulting in stronger and more aesthetically pleasing welds. How Does Flux Core Wire Differ From Solid Mig Wire?

Flux core welding wire, like E71T-GS, contains flux for gasless welding, useful outdoors. Solid MIG wire requires shielding gas and offers cleaner welds with less smoke. Flux core is easier for beginners and works well on rusted or dirty metals, while solid wire suits precise, indoor welding.

What Diameter Wire Is Recommended For Mig Welding?

Common diameters are 0. 030 and 0. 035 inches, like those in Blue Demon and VEVOR wires. Smaller diameters (0. 030) offer better control and are good for thin metals. Larger diameters (0. 035) provide deeper penetration for thicker materials.

Choose based on your project thickness and welder specs.
